Receiver/Pager/Caller Power
Supply voltage: DC 3.7V (rechargeable battery)
Charging voltage: DC 5V
Operating frequency: 443.92MHz
Current consumption: 10±5mA
Operating current: 75±10mA (vibration), 100±20mA (vibration + buzzing)
Receiver sensitivity: -107±2dBm
Battery capacity: 360mAh
Encoding: Learning code (AM)
Dimensions: 4910111mm
Base Station Power
Supply voltage: DC 12V/3A power adapter
Operating frequency: 433.92MHz
Current consumption: 24±5mA
Transmission current: 100±30mA
Encoding: learning code (AM)
Dimensions: 15030033mm
Connect the base station to power. Initially, the device will perform an automatic self-test procedure, and then the power indicator will light up.
Press and hold the “ON/OFF Button” for 3 seconds on the right side of each receiver. Upon activation, the pager will vibrate and emit a sound three times. LED1 will start blinking at 3-second intervals, indicating that the pager is on and in standby mode. Place the pager in the charging slot. The pager will automatically vibrate and beep five times, after which the blue LED will start blinking, indicating charging mode.
When a customer places an order, the staff hands them a pager and records the pager number.
When the order is ready, the staff selects the appropriate order number on the base station. The order readiness notification is sent to the pager, which will emit a signal in the form of vibration/beeping/flashing for 5 minutes. After this period, only LED3 will continue to blink. Press the “ON/OFF Button” or place the pager in the charging slot to reset the receiver to standby mode.
The customer returns the receiver to the staff. The staff places the pager in the charging slot of the base station.
During receiver charging, press its number on the keyboard, and the LEDs on the receiver will confirm its position in the base.
During daily operations, the receivers are kept on at all times. If not used for an extended period (after closing the establishment), please turn off the receivers.
For prolonged periods of inactivity, ensure the receivers are charged and verify they are fully charged before handing them to a customer.
The receiver must be paired with the base station before use. How to perform pairing? See the “Pairing Operation” section below.
Notes: To perform the pairing operation, the label must be removed. The pairing button is covered under the label.
When the receiver’s voltage is lower than DC3.2V, it has low power. LED1 will light up and the pager will start to vibrate, indicating that the receiver needs to be charged. Place the receiver in the charging slot. The blue LED will start to blink.
Once fully charged, the LED will emit a steady light.
FAQ – Useful Questions and Answers
Despite connecting the set, the display shows no number
The power supply is damaged
Replace the power supply with a new one
The receiver’s range has deteriorated
Low receiver battery level
Ensure the receiver is charged. If in doubt, charge the receiver.
The receiver does not respond to the signal from the base station
Pairing has been erased. Wrong pager number selected.
Perform the receiver pairing operation
Forgotten receiver number
Perform the pairing erasure operation and then reassign the correct number to the receiver through pairing.
